From unknown Sat Jun 21 10:43:33 2025 X-Loop: owner@emacsbugs.donarmstrong.com Subject: bug#2729: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' Reply-To: "Roland Winkler" , 2729@debbugs.gnu.org Resent-From: "Roland Winkler" Resent-To: bug-submit-list@lists.donarmstrong.com Resent-CC: Emacs Bugs Resent-Date: Fri, 20 Mar 2009 16:50: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-Emacs-PR-Message: report 2729 X-Emacs-PR-Package: emacs X-Emacs-PR-Keywords: Received: via spool by submit@emacsbugs.donarmstrong.com id=B.123756727131775 (code B ref -1); Fri, 20 Mar 2009 16:50:02 +0000 Received: (at submit) by emacsbugs.donarmstrong.com; 20 Mar 2009 16:41:11 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=0.0 required=4.0 tests=none aut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from fencepost.gnu.org (fencepost.gnu.org [140.186.70.10]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2KGf7as031769 for ; Fri, 20 Mar 2009 09:41:08 -0700 Received: from mx10.gnu.org ([199.232.76.166]:52022) by fencepost.gnu.org with esmtp (Exim 4.67) (envelope-from ) id 1LkhmM-0004Us-Kq for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:06 -0400 Received: from Debian-exim by monty-python.gnu.org with spam-scanned (Exim 4.60) (envelope-from ) id 1LkhmJ-0004eI-Ec for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:06 -0400 Received: from tfkpsv.physik.uni-erlangen.de ([131.188.164.197]:5204)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1LkhmJ-0004dq-4x for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:03 -0400 Received: from tfkp07.physik.uni-erlangen.de (tfkp07.physik.uni-erlangen.de [131.188.164.207]) by tfkpsv.physik.uni-erlangen.de (Postfix) with ESMTP id 554D6212EA for ; Fri, 20 Mar 2009 17:41:01 +0100 (CET)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Message-ID: <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> Date: Fri, 20 Mar 2009 17:41:00 +0100 From: "Roland Winkler" To: emacs-pretest-bug@gnu.org X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.4-2.6 When I use dired-do-chmod to change file modes with an argument like `g=', I get the error message Parse error in modes near `g=' There is no such error with GNU Emacs 22.2. In GNU Emacs 23.0.90.1 (i686-pc-linux-gnu, GTK+ Version 2.14.4) of 2009-02-23 on regnitz Windowing system distributor `The X.Org Foundation', version 11.0.10502000 From unknown Sat Jun 21 10:43:33 2025 X-Loop: owner@emacsbugs.donarmstrong.com Subject: bug#2729: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' Reply-To: Glenn Morris , 2729@debbugs.gnu.org Resent-From: Glenn Morris Resent-To: bug-submit-list@lists.donarmstrong.com Resent-CC: Emacs Bugs Resent-Date: Sat, 21 Mar 2009 02:35:05 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-Emacs-PR-Message: followup 2729 X-Emacs-PR-Package: emacs X-Emacs-PR-Keywords: Received: via spool by 2729-submit@emacsbugs.donarmstrong.com id=B2729.123760236125447 (code B ref 2729); Sat, 21 Mar 2009 02:35:05 +0000 Received: (at 2729) by emacsbugs.donarmstrong.com; 21 Mar 2009 02:26:01 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=-6.0 required=4.0 tests=HAS_BUG_NUMBER, X_DEBBUGS_NO_ACK aut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from fencepost.gnu.org (fencepost.gnu.org [140.186.70.10]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2L2PwaD025441 for <2729@emacsbugs.donarmstrong.com>; Fri, 20 Mar 2009 19:26:00 -0700 Received: from rgm by fencepost.gnu.org with local (Exim 4.67) (envelope-from ) id 1LkquM-0006Dc-2o; Fri, 20 Mar 2009 22:25:58 -0400 From: Glenn Morris To: Roland Winkler Cc: 2729@debbugs.gnu.org References: <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> X-Spook: cybercash Glock doctrine Firewalls Fedayeen InfoSec X-Ran: TWfkj3uO6v&%?2Bvs`)Ik+s{C`hxIx+c?Yq;`@!_0m%"q9jzAQXp2nNWnW,ASyWIK,e>0+ X-Hue: cyan X-Attribution: GM Date: Fri, 20 Mar 2009 22:25:57 -0400 Message-ID: <5rr60rd32i.fsf@fencepost.gnu.org> User-Agent: Gnus (www.gnus.org), GNU Emacs (www.gnu.org/software/emacs/)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ii "Roland Winkler" wrote: > When I use dired-do-chmod to change file modes with an argument like > `g=', I get the error message > > Parse error in modes near `g=' Works for me. emacs -Q M-x dired RET RET (move to a file) M g=rw -> group permissions set to "rw". More complex things, like "u=rw,g=r,o+r" also work fine. What is the precise argument which causes file-modes-symbolic-to-number to fail? From unknown Sat Jun 21 10:43:33 2025 X-Loop: owner@emacsbugs.donarmstrong.com Subject: bug#2729: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' Reply-To: "Roland Winkler" , 2729@debbugs.gnu.org Resent-From: "Roland Winkler" Resent-To: bug-submit-list@lists.donarmstrong.com Resent-CC: Emacs Bugs Resent-Date: Sat, 21 Mar 2009 05:25:03 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-Emacs-PR-Message: followup 2729 X-Emacs-PR-Package: emacs X-Emacs-PR-Keywords: Received: via spool by 2729-submit@emacsbugs.donarmstrong.com id=B2729.12376127125747 (code B ref 2729); Sat, 21 Mar 2009 05:25:03 +0000 Received: (at 2729) by emacsbugs.donarmstrong.com; 21 Mar 2009 05:18:32 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=-3.0 required=4.0 tests=HAS_BUG_NUMBER aut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from tfkpsv.physik.uni-erlangen.de (tfkpsv.physik.uni-erlangen.de [131.188.164.197]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2L5IS5k005740 for <2729@emacsbugs.donarmstrong.com>; Fri, 20 Mar 2009 22:18:30 -0700 Received: from tfkp07.physik.uni-erlangen.de (tfkp07.physik.uni-erlangen.de [131.188.164.207]) by tfkpsv.physik.uni-erlangen.de (Postfix) with ESMTP id 551A5212EA; Sat, 21 Mar 2009 06:18:24 +0100 (CET)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Message-ID: <18884.30880.638185.688451@tfkp07.physik.uni-erlangen.de> Date: Sat, 21 Mar 2009 06:18:24 +0100 From: "Roland Winkler" To: Glenn Morris Cc: 2729@debbugs.gnu.org In-Reply-To: <5rr60rd32i.fsf@fencepost.gnu.org> References: <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> <5rr60rd32i.fsf@fencepost.gnu.org> X-Mailer: VM 8.0.9 under Emacs 22.2.1 (i686-pc-linux-gnu) On Fri Mar 20 2009 Glenn Morris wrote: > "Roland Winkler" wrote: > > When I use dired-do-chmod to change file modes with an argument like > > `g=', I get the error message > > What is the precise argument which causes > file-modes-symbolic-to-number to fail? As I said in the original bug report, an argument like `g=' which removes all permissions for group does not work for me. Roland From unknown Sat Jun 21 10:43:33 2025 MIME-Version: 1.0 X-Mailer: MIME-tools 5.420 (Entity 5.420) X-Loop: owner@emacsbugs.donarmstrong.com From: help-debbugs@gnu.org (Emacs bug Tracking System) To: "Roland Winkler" Subject: bug#2729 closed by Chong Yidong (Re: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=') Message-ID: References: <87ab7ena36.fsf@cyd.mit.edu> <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> X-Emacs-PR-Message: they-closed 2729 X-Emacs-PR-Package: emacs Reply-To: 2729@debbugs.gnu.org Date: Sat, 21 Mar 2009 16:00:03 +0000 Content-Type: multipart/mixed; boundary="----------=_1237651203-12638-1" This is a multi-part message in MIME format... ------------=_1237651203-12638-1 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="utf-8" This is an automatic notification regarding your bug report which was filed against the emacs package: #2729: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g= =3D' It has been closed by Chong Yidong . Their explanation is attached below along with your original report. If this explanation is unsatisfactory and you have not received a better one in a separate message then please contact Chong Yidong by replying to this email. --=20 2729: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=3D2729 Emacs Bug Tracking System Contact help-debbugs@gnu.org with problems ------------=_1237651203-12638-1 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at 2729-done) by emacsbugs.donarmstrong.com; 21 Mar 2009 15:55:08 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=0.0 required=4.0 tests=none aut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from cyd.mit.edu (CYD.MIT.EDU [18.115.2.24]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2LFt5Xs011543 for <2729-done@emacsbugs.donarmstrong.com>; Sat, 21 Mar 2009 08:55:06 -0700 Received: by cyd.mit.edu (Postfix, from userid 1000) id 8292F57E20B; Sat, 21 Mar 2009 11:56:29 -0400 (EDT) From: Chong Yidong To: "Roland Winkler" Cc: 2729-done@debbugs.gnu.org Subject: Re: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' Date: Sat, 21 Mar 2009 11:56:29 -0400 Message-ID: <87ab7ena36.fsf@cyd.mit.edu>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ii > When I use dired-do-chmod to change file modes with an argument like > `g=', I get the error message > > Parse error in modes near `g=' I've checked in a fix. Thanks for the report. ------------=_1237651203-12638-1 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at submit) by emacsbugs.donarmstrong.com; 20 Mar 2009 16:41:11 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=0.0 required=4.0 tests=none aut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from fencepost.gnu.org (fencepost.gnu.org [140.186.70.10]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2KGf7as031769 for ; Fri, 20 Mar 2009 09:41:08 -0700 Received: from mx10.gnu.org ([199.232.76.166]:52022) by fencepost.gnu.org with esmtp (Exim 4.67) (envelope-from ) id 1LkhmM-0004Us-Kq for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:06 -0400 Received: from Debian-exim by monty-python.gnu.org with spam-scanned (Exim 4.60) (envelope-from ) id 1LkhmJ-0004eI-Ec for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:06 -0400 Received: from tfkpsv.physik.uni-erlangen.de ([131.188.164.197]:5204)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1LkhmJ-0004dq-4x for emacs-pretest-bug@gnu.org; Fri, 20 Mar 2009 12:41:03 -0400 Received: from tfkp07.physik.uni-erlangen.de (tfkp07.physik.uni-erlangen.de [131.188.164.207]) by tfkpsv.physik.uni-erlangen.de (Postfix) with ESMTP id 554D6212EA for ; Fri, 20 Mar 2009 17:41:01 +0100 (CET)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Message-ID: <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> Date: Fri, 20 Mar 2009 17:41:00 +0100 From: "Roland Winkler" To: emacs-pretest-bug@gnu.org Subject: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.4-2.6 When I use dired-do-chmod to change file modes with an argument like `g=', I get the error message Parse error in modes near `g=' There is no such error with GNU Emacs 22.2. In GNU Emacs 23.0.90.1 (i686-pc-linux-gnu, GTK+ Version 2.14.4) of 2009-02-23 on regnitz Windowing system distributor `The X.Org Foundation', version 11.0.10502000 ------------=_1237651203-12638-1-- From unknown Sat Jun 21 10:43:33 2025 X-Loop: owner@emacsbugs.donarmstrong.com Subject: bug#2729: 23.0.90; file-modes-symbolic-to-number: Parse error in modes near `g=' Reply-To: Glenn Morris , 2729@debbugs.gnu.org Resent-From: Glenn Morris Resent-To: bug-submit-list@lists.donarmstrong.com Resent-CC: Emacs Bugs Resent-Date: Sat, 21 Mar 2009 19:00:03 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-Emacs-PR-Message: followup 2729 X-Emacs-PR-Package: emacs X-Emacs-PR-Keywords: Received: via spool by 2729-submit@emacsbugs.donarmstrong.com id=B2729.123766168725369 (code B ref 2729); Sat, 21 Mar 2009 19:00:03 +0000 Received: (at 2729) by emacsbugs.donarmstrong.com; 21 Mar 2009 18:54:47 +0000 X-Spam-Checker-Version: SpamAssassin 3.2.5-bugs.debian.org_2005_01_02 (2008-06-10) on rzlab.ucr.edu X-Spam-Level: X-Spam-Bayes: score:0.5 Bayes not run. spammytokens:Tokens not available. hammytokens:Tokens not available. X-Spam-Status: No, score=-6.0 required=4.0 tests=HAS_BUG_NUMBER, X_DEBBUGS_NO_ACK autolearn=ham version=3.2.5-bugs.debian.org_2005_01_02 Received: from fencepost.gnu.org (fencepost.gnu.org [140.186.70.10]) by rzlab.ucr.edu (8.13.8/8.13.8/Debian-3) with ESMTP id n2LIsiM3025362 for <2729@emacsbugs.donarmstrong.com>; Sat, 21 Mar 2009 11:54:45 -0700 Received: from rgm by fencepost.gnu.org with local (Exim 4.67) (envelope-from ) id 1Ll6LB-0007X2-83; Sat, 21 Mar 2009 14:54:41 -0400 From: Glenn Morris To: "Roland Winkler" Cc: 2729@debbugs.gnu.org References: <18883.50972.10335.695223@tfkp07.physik.uni-erlangen.de> <5rr60rd32i.fsf@fencepost.gnu.org> <18884.30880.638185.688451@tfkp07.physik.uni-erlangen.de> X-Spook: brigand 9/11 ASLET kilo class Tony Blair Capricorn X-Ran: Hbj'Ft}l/"%JL~rDD?p>-@,H)K((geAv2u\;Fthjf~.C/P46_H?&>78w:m~<:]6r}2}$1D X-Hue: green X-Attribution: GM Date: Sat, 21 Mar 2009 14:54:41 -0400 In-Reply-To: <18884.30880.638185.688451@tfkp07.physik.uni-erlangen.de> (Roland Winkler's message of "Sat, 21 Mar 2009 06:18:24 +0100") Message-ID: User-Agent: Gnus (www.gnus.org), GNU Emacs (www.gnu.org/software/emacs/) M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ii "Roland Winkler" wrote: > As I said in the original bug report, an argument like `g=' which Oh, sorry, I misunderstood. Idiots like me need explicit recipes from emacs -Q.